PRESIDENT FOTOS DIMITRIOU / SCULPTOR
Fotos Dimitriou was born in Famagusta, Cyprus, in 1955.
He studied Porcelain and Ceramics at the Academy of Arts, Architecture and Design in Prague (1976–1983), earning the title of Academic Sculptor (Master of Arts).
Since 1983, he has been based in Larnaca, where he works from his art studio. Throughout his career, Fotos has participated in numerous solo and group exhibitions in Cyprus and internationally, showcasing his work in Italy, Malta, Belgium, Greece, Australia, France, Germany, and Egypt. Notably, he won third prize at the Pan-Hellenic Ceramic Exhibition in both 1995 and 1999.
His talent was further recognized with invitations to the Cairo International Ceramics Biennale (2000) and the Design Biennale in Saint Etienne, France (2001).

VICE PRESIDENT PANTELIS FOTIOU / ICONOGRAPHER
Pantelis Fotiou is an icon painter.
He studied Theology at the Aristotelian University in Salonica Greece.
From a young age he studied Byzantine iconography with know teachers. And also, he studied the fresco technique under Mihai Morosan. His icons and byzantine frescos can be found in numerous temples in Cyprus and abroad.

SECRETARY AIMILIA ANDREOU / CULTURAL PRACTITIONER, RUSSIAN PHILOLOGIST
Aimilia Andreou studied Russian Philology (Russian Language and Literature) at Yerevan State University and later obtained a Master’s degree in Teaching Russian as a Foreign Language from Tver State University.
She currently teaches Russian and is the co-founder of the online language institution Rusophia. At the same time, she is completing postgraduate studies in Cultural Policy and Development at the Open University of Cyprus.
Through her studies, she has developed skills related to the relationship between art and society, cultural policy and management, cultural economics, museology, and cultural communication. In addition, she has acquired knowledge and experience in the management of cultural organisations and projects, cultural production, cultural policy implementation, and the role of culture in local and urban development.
As part of her studies, she has completed two successful placements in the cultural sector with Larnaka2030 and the Larnaca Biennale.

TREASURER MARIA PAPADOPOULOU / CULTURAL PROJECT MANAGER,
DIRECTOR @ WONDERDOTS
Maria is a marketer and event planner.
She studied in London and holds a Bachelor Degree in Marketing from Middlesex University and two Masters degrees in International Management from Kings University and Investment Management from Cass Business School.
After a five-year work experience in Athens in the banking sector she recited in her hometown Larnaca in 2011. She is now the founder and director of WonderDots Ltd offering new age marketing, event planning and project services.
Throughout her career she has planned numerous unique and successful events including Larnaca Biennale.

MEMBER KONSTANTINOS CHARILAOU / DESIGNER
Konstantinos is an interdisciplinary designer, STEAM educator, and event planner, currently contributing his expertise at Youth Makerspace Larnaka, a cutting-edge hub for innovation and education under the Youth Board of Cyprus.
He is also a Creative Strategist at Simlead Product Design, where he develops innovative strategies, facilitates design thinking workshops, and leads product development initiatives.
A graduate of the IED Milano - European Institute of Design, Konstantinos specializes in designing and facilitating workshops, leading impactful events like Makerfair, and engaging diverse audiences in the dynamic world of STEAM (Science, Technology, Engineering, Arts, Mathematics).

MEMBER MARIA KOUMPAROU / CULTURAL WORKER
Maria Koumparou holds a bachelor’s degree in criminology from the University of Surrey and in a Master’s degree in Social Research from the University of Edinburgh. For the last five years she has worked in the field of national and European programmes, developing competitive proposals for funding research and education projects (IDEA, Erasmus+, CERV, AMIF, Horizon, JUSTICE) as well as managing projects.
During her career, she has worked with a variety of social groups at local and European level – including artists, youth groups, cultural organisations, and LGBT+ groups – with the aim to enhance their personal and professional development and their active participation in the community and society.
She has developed a number of training programmes and has organised and coordinated presentations, events, training workshops and activities, and seminars.

MEMBER THEODOROS PHILIPPOU /EVENT ORGANIZER
Born in Athienou, Cyprus, in 1970 Graduated from Pancyprian Gymnasium in Nicosia.
Moved to the UK in 2005. Repatriated back to Cyprus in 2020. Founded and managed The O Gallery from 2020 to 2023.
Lives and works in Larnaca.
